If you need to reach out for support, you can contact Lifeline 24 hours a day on 13-11-14.After facing deep personal despair, Dr Paul Callaghan found healing and purpose through Aboriginal law, culture, and connection to Country. In this powerful conversation, Paul shares how Indigenous wisdom reframes life around care, unity, and responsibility rather than rights and competition. Through stories of self-discovery and cultural insight, he reveals that true wellbeing comes when all things (people, nature, and community) are well. Paul reminds us that leadership begins with love, healing begins with connection, and that to live the best story possible, we must first remember who we are and where we come from.Paul is an Aboriginal man belonging to the land of the Worimi people, now called Port Stephens. He occupies Professor roles at the University of Melbourne, RMIT University and Charles Sturt University. Paul’s best-selling book, The Dreaming Path, received the Australian Book Industry Award for ‘Small Publisher’s Adult Book of the Year’ in 2023, and his children’s book, Adventures on the Dreaming Path, was published on 1 July 2025.For more information, click here Paul’s WebsiteThe Dreaming PathAdventures on the Dreaming PathUnSchoolsLand recognition
